如何通过Sublime Text提升Ruby编程效率?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1350个文字,预计阅读时间需要6分钟。
Sublime Text 是一款功能强大的文本编辑器,通过安装合适的插件和配置,可以显著提升 Ruby 开发体验。以下是一些关键点:
解决方案
Sublime Text本身是一个强大的文本编辑器,但要充分发挥其在Ruby开发中的潜力,需要进行一些优化。这包括安装必要的插件、配置代码提示、设置代码格式化工具,以及熟悉常用的快捷键。
如何选择适合自己的Sublime Text Ruby插件?
选择插件时,需要考虑以下几个方面:代码提示和自动完成、语法高亮和错误检查、代码片段(snippets)、代码格式化、以及项目管理功能。
RSpec和TestUnit支持: 编写测试是Ruby开发的重要组成部分。
SublimeRSpec 和
TestUnit 这样的插件可以帮助你更方便地运行和管理测试。例如,你可以直接在Sublime Text中运行单个测试或整个测试套件,并查看测试结果。
代码片段(Snippets): Snippets可以极大地提高编码速度。例如,你可以创建一个snippet,输入
class,然后自动展开成
class MyClass\n def initialize\n end\n end。Sublime Text允许你自定义snippets,或者使用现有的snippets包,例如
Ruby Bundle。
语法高亮和错误检查: 确保你的Sublime Text正确地高亮显示Ruby代码,并能实时检查语法错误。
Ruby Bundle 通常包含一个不错的Ruby语法高亮方案。
本文共计1350个文字,预计阅读时间需要6分钟。
Sublime Text 是一款功能强大的文本编辑器,通过安装合适的插件和配置,可以显著提升 Ruby 开发体验。以下是一些关键点:
解决方案
Sublime Text本身是一个强大的文本编辑器,但要充分发挥其在Ruby开发中的潜力,需要进行一些优化。这包括安装必要的插件、配置代码提示、设置代码格式化工具,以及熟悉常用的快捷键。
如何选择适合自己的Sublime Text Ruby插件?
选择插件时,需要考虑以下几个方面:代码提示和自动完成、语法高亮和错误检查、代码片段(snippets)、代码格式化、以及项目管理功能。
RSpec和TestUnit支持: 编写测试是Ruby开发的重要组成部分。
SublimeRSpec 和
TestUnit 这样的插件可以帮助你更方便地运行和管理测试。例如,你可以直接在Sublime Text中运行单个测试或整个测试套件,并查看测试结果。
代码片段(Snippets): Snippets可以极大地提高编码速度。例如,你可以创建一个snippet,输入
class,然后自动展开成
class MyClass\n def initialize\n end\n end。Sublime Text允许你自定义snippets,或者使用现有的snippets包,例如
Ruby Bundle。
语法高亮和错误检查: 确保你的Sublime Text正确地高亮显示Ruby代码,并能实时检查语法错误。
Ruby Bundle 通常包含一个不错的Ruby语法高亮方案。

